During the summer months, especially when we’re in Italy, tomatoes are always plentiful. So much so, that we often make fresh tomato sauce out of them so they don’t go to waste. Everyone grows tomatoes in Italy and so, when friends and family visit, it seems that the appropriate thing to bring us is tomatoes, which we really appreciate since we don’t have our own garden to grow produce in Italy!

For this classic tomato and cucumber salad, you only need these two ingredients and a few seasonings. It’s perfect next to some BBQ’ed meats or fish. Add some diced mozzarella and you have a full meal!

The below doses are strictly guidelines. As with any salad or even soups, you can adjust accordingly to family size and serving amounts.

Allow salted tomatoes to stand for a few minutes before adding the rest of the ingredients. This allows for the salt to release their juices, for a juicier salad.

Italian Cucumber & Tomato Salad

Ingredients 


2 – 3 vine ripened or farm fresh tomatoes (it’s important that the tomatoes are fresh and juicy), diced
1 teaspoon salt (or to taste)
1 large English cucumber, peeled and diced or sliced
2 – 3 scallions or 1/2 red onion, diced
3 – 4 fresh basil leaves, torn to pieces
3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
1 teaspoon high-quality (ideally imported) dry oregano 

Directions

  1. Dice the tomatoes and add them to a bowl with the salt. Allow to stand for several minutes so the tomatoes release their juices. (You can skip this step if you are in a hurry.)
  2. Add the diced cucumber, scallions, basil, oil and oregano, and mix well. Allow to stand just a few minutes longer so flavors develop. Then serve!

*Variations: 
To this salad you can add 1 – 2 cans of tuna packed in oil (reduce the amount of oil if adding the tuna with its oil), small mozzarella balls or crusty bread cubes.
